		<description>Julián,

I don&#039;t see why it doesn&#039;t work this way. I&#039;ve been the option &quot;Put sent messages in: #mh/Boîte aux lettres/sent&quot; for a long time now and I just checked on my gmail account and I can see the mail I send from claws-mail. 
To send your email are you using the Gmail SMTP server? (smtp.gmail.com). On my settings, I use SMTP on port 587 and I also have SMTP AUTH and STARTTLS enabled.
You could also check that your &quot;From&quot; field is correct and matches your login to Gmail.
That&#039;s all I can think of.
Hope this helps.</description>

		<description>Hi Arnaud, 

thanks for this useful guide on setting up Claws to play nicely with Gmail/GoogleHosted accounts.

I followed it but I&#039;m having just one little issue, I think.

I&#039;ve chosen to save the sent mail on the local Mailbox (MH), as you suggest, by configuring the &quot;Put sent messages in: (...)/sent&quot; option.
Then, sent mails are saved on that folder

But then, contrary to what your guide says, sent mails are not being saved also on the imap &quot;Sent&quot; folder. 
It&#039;s weird, because I wonder: how does Gmail &quot;know&quot; that I&#039;m saving my sent emails locally, so they &quot;decide&quot; not to save it also on the imap &quot;Sent&quot; folder?
Maybe Claws mail somehow &quot;flags&quot; the email being sent and so, when Gmail process it, Gmail decides not to save it on the &quot;Sent&quot; folder?

Any advice will be appreciated.
